Our philosophy of Construction
Management is simply to provide up-front planning to yield
long-term value. We call it Value-on-investment.
This process starts with the following phases: |
|
- Identify project goals
- Assist in selection of professionals
- Establish operational relationships between primary professionals.
- Establish Construction Management Team
- Establish project organization chart
|
|
|
- Establish lines of communications
- Construction cost input on feasibility studies
- Establish project criteria
- Analyze alternate construction methods based on cost and
schedule
- Develop overall project schedule
|
|
|
- Contribute to preliminary design
- Work closely with the architect and engineer
- Maintain control to insure on time delivery within budget
- Provide preliminary estimates
- Develop work flow schedule to accommodate design/construction
overlap
- Assist design team in preparing bid packages for earliest
release
- Develop cash flow schedule
|
|
|
- Contribute local construction knowledge
- Pre-qualify bidders
- Review and compare bids
- Recommend vendor selection
- Assist in preparation of contract documents
- Secure required building permits
|
|
|
- Form on site construction team
- Establish lines of communication between Owner, Architect/Engineer,
Construction manager with subcontractors and suppliers
- Facilitate on-site communication
- Familiarize all concerned with schedule requirements,
correspondence, shop drawings, quality control tests, job
safety, site security and payment
- Insure that needed materials will be available
- Maintain a full-time representative on site
- Compare results with time/cost projections
- Inspect work quality, continually
- Ongoing update of construction schedule
- Establish appropriate safety programs
